<em>Srinivasa Ramanujan FRS was an Indian mathematician who lived during the British Rule in India. Though he had almost no formal training in pure mathematics, he made substantial contributions to mathematical</em><em>.</em>
<em>Indian mathematician Srinivasa Ramanujan made contributions to the theory of numbers, including pioneering discoveries of the properties of the partition function. His papers were published in English and European journals, and in 1918 he was elected to the Royal Society of London.</em>

In what three ways did globalization affect Americans in the 1990s? Here are the most appropriate answers:
- It resulted in foreign investment opportunities for entrepreneurs.
- It increased the gap between wealthy and poor individuals.
- It raised concerns that Americans might lose their jobs to foreign workers.
<h3>What is globalization?</h3>
The term "globalization" is used to describe how trade and technology have increased connectivity and interdependence around the world. The scope of globalization also includes the resulting changes in the economy and society.
Globalization is the blending of national and international markets in a way that permits unrestricted trade between individuals around the world.
